I have submitted my EE application under CEC in late march 2017. It is now under processing at the BGS IP1 stage since April 19th.

I have just found out the in the employment record section, I attached my original job contract signed years ago with the letter head as company logo "ABC" and footer with the company name, phone number and address as:
"ABC Technologies Inc. XXX-XXX-XXXX XXX XX ST, XXX, ON"

I also attached the employment letter. It has the same company logo "ABC" in the header. The footer, however, shows as "ABC Services Inc. XXX-XXX-XXXX XXX XX ST, XXX, ON". And its content states that I have been working at "ABC Technologies Inc.".

ABC is the alias I use for my company name. The only differences here is the company name ("ABC Technologies Inc." vs "ABC Services Inc."), and all other fields including the phone number and the address are the same.

The paystubs I attached also all has the company name as "ABC Technologies Inc."

Our company has been called as "ABC Technologies Inc" and "ABC Services Inc" is actually a new company that my boss recently registered to roll out a new service with partners.

I guess the HR printed the employment letter accidentally on the new company's letter head paper....Since the employment letter with job duties and salary & perks declaration is the most important letter, I am a bit worried. What should I do? From the CIC website, CIC does not seem to accept any new document after you submitted your application unless they ask for it.

I have heard that they just reject you if the employment letter has discrepancies during the final eligibility review stage for CEC applicants.

If there is any public information freely available on the internet about the name change of the company, then you may try raising a CSE citing the same. CIC tends to be very picky if the Work Permit is closed though, in that case the name of the Employer is extremely important. I remember reading about an application which was refused since the the work permit did not have "Inc" at the end of the company name.
